Output 32f4633d63b80512ee515ec090db67dcfaede2f9a41065880ef0d892feaffe8d:2

value
206590
script pubkey
OP_0 OP_PUSHBYTES_20 3a6e12e9878ad71d731883b4af14aefa4fb4b125
address
tb1q8fhp96v83tt36uccsw62799wlf8mfvf9pjq7z2
transaction
32f4633d63b80512ee515ec090db67dcfaede2f9a41065880ef0d892feaffe8d
confirmations
82447
spent
true